Schr\"odinger operators on the half-line with integrable complex potentials

Abstract

In our previous work, we introduced the concept of a \emph{spectral pair} for a half-line Schr\"odinger operator with a \emph{complex} bounded potential qq, serving as a substitute for the spectral measure in a non-self-adjoint setting. In this paper, we study the case of qL1(R+)q \in L^1(\mathbb{R}_+). We derive explicit formulas for the spectral pair in terms of the Jost solutions of a system of two equations naturally associated with the non-self-adjoint Schr\"odinger operator. A key component of our work, which is of independent interest, is the existence proof and analysis of these Jost solutions.
